Bert Leston Taylor

Bert Leston Taylor

Bert Leston Taylor was an influential American columnist, humorist, poet, and author known for his sharp wit and engaging prose. He began his career in journalism at the young age of seventeen, quickly establishing himself in the literary world. By the time he was twenty-one, he had already ventured into writing librettos, showcasing his versatility and creativity. Taylor's literary significance grew as he became a prominent figure in the early 20th century Chicago renaissance, contributing to the vibrant cultural landscape of the city. His work as a columnist earned him widespread acclaim, making him one of the most celebrated writers of his time. Among his notable works, Taylor's poetry and essays often reflected his keen observations of society and human nature, blending humor with poignant insights. His ability to capture the essence of contemporary life through a humorous lens set him apart from his peers. Taylor's legacy endures as a testament to the rich literary culture of early 20th century America, influencing future generations of writers and humorists who followed in his footsteps. His contributions to journalism and literature continue to be recognized for their originality and depth, solidifying his place in American literary history.
